EDITORS COMMENTS
This engraving showcases the portrait of John Farquhar, a prominent Scottish merchant and entrepreneur of the 18th century. Created by William Thomas Fry, this print captures the essence of Farquhar's influential role in British history. Farquhar's piercing gaze and distinguished attire reflect his status as a successful businessman during this era. With meticulous detail, Fry brings to life every aspect of Farquhar's character, from his confident posture to the subtle lines etched on his face that speak volumes about his experiences. As a merchant, Farquhar played an integral part in Britain's economic growth. His involvement in various industries such as gunpowder trade further solidified his reputation as an astute entrepreneur. This satirical caricature not only highlights Farquhar's achievements but also provides insight into the social and political climate of Great Britain at that time. The print is a testament to British culture and European history, capturing both the spirit of entrepreneurship and the allure of 18th-century fashion. It serves as a reminder of how individuals like John Farquhar shaped their nations through their business acumen and determination. Displayed within private collections today, this engraving continues to inspire admiration for its subject matter while offering viewers a glimpse into an important chapter in British commerce.
